EUR/JPY Price Forecast: Tests 185.00 after breaking above moving averages
EUR/JPY gains ground for the second successive day, trading around 185.00 during the Asian hours on Monday. The currency cross holds a constructive near-term bias as it trades above the nine-period and 50-period Exponential Moving Averages (EMAs).

The volume-weighted average price (VWAP) is reinforcing underlying demand around 184.31. The 14-day Relative Strength Index (RSI) hovers near 51, reflecting neutral-to-firm momentum as the spot price solidifies above key dynamic support levels.

The technical analysis of the daily chart suggests that the EUR/JPY cross is remaining within the symmetrical triangle, indicating that both buyers and sellers are becoming increasingly aggressive, squeezing the price into a tighter and tighter range. Neither side has taken control yet, creating a temporary balance of power.

Further advances would support the EUR/JPY cross to test the upper boundary of the symmetrical triangle around 185.90. A break above the triangle would cause the bullish emergence and expose the all-time high of 187.95, which was recorded on April 17.

On the downside, initial support lies at the 50-day EMA of 184.91, followed by the nine-day EMA at 184.71. Further declines would expose the symmetrical triangle’s lower boundary around 183.60, followed by the four-month low of 181.87, recorded on March 16, and the six-month low of 180.81.

The heat map shows percentage changes of major currencies against each other. The base currency is picked from the left column, while the quote currency is picked from the top row. For example, if you pick the Euro from the left column and move along the horizontal line to the US Dollar, the percentage change displayed in the box will represent EUR (base)/USD (quote).
